For many years, researchers have actually recognized and classified different parenting styles based upon the dimensions of warmth/responsiveness and control/demandingness. These styles stand for broad patterns of adult habits and mindsets that affect exactly how parents interact with their kids. While real-life parenting frequently includes a mix of these styles, comprehending the unique characteristics of each supplies beneficial understandings right into their possible effects.
Among the most widely acknowledged frameworks classifies parenting styles right into four major kinds: Authoritative, Tyrannical, Permissive, and Neglectful.
The Authoritative Moms And Dad: A Equilibrium of Warmth and Firmness.
Usually considered the most efficient parenting design, the reliable strategy is defined by high levels of both warmth and control. Authoritative moms and dads are supporting, responsive, and supportive of their kids's demands. They develop clear regulations and expectations yet additionally explain the thinking behind them, promoting understanding and a sense of justness. They are assertive but not invasive or restrictive.
Youngsters elevated by authoritative parents often tend to display several positive qualities. They are typically much more autonomous, liable, socially skilled, and academically successful. They establish solid analytic skills, have higher self-worth, and are better able to control their feelings. The equilibrium of love and structure provided by reliable parenting promotes a protected accessory and motivates the growth of internal control in kids.
The Authoritarian Moms And Dad: High Control, Low Heat.
On the other hand, the tyrannical parenting design is identified by high needs and reduced responsiveness. Authoritarian parents are frequently described as stringent, requiring, and managing. They establish inflexible regulations and expect unquestioning obedience, frequently using penalty instead of description to enforce them. Interaction often tends to be one-way, with little space for the child's point of views or sensations.
Children increased in authoritarian families might show obedience and conformity but usually at the expenditure of their freedom, self-worth, and happiness. They might be extra distressed, unconfident, and prone to aggressiveness or withdrawal. The lack of warmth and open communication can prevent the advancement of depend on and psychological intimacy between moms and dad and child. While these children might carry out well academically out of anxiety of penalty, they may do not have intrinsic motivation and struggle with decision-making.
The Permissive Moms And Dad: High Warmth, Low Control.
Permissive moms and dads, likewise referred to as indulgent parents, are identified by high degrees of warmth and reduced degrees of control. They are usually supporting and approving but set couple of limits and make few needs on their kids. They often tend to be forgiving, avoid confrontation, and might act more like buddies than authority figures.
Kids elevated by permissive moms and dads might be spontaneous, absence self-control, and have trouble complying with guidelines. They may likewise exhibit immaturity, disrespect for authority, and a sense of entitlement. While they may have high self-worth due to the constant affirmation, they typically lack the self-control and duty required to navigate the intricacies of life. The absence of clear expectations and constant limits can leave children really feeling unconfident and unprepared for the real world.
The Neglectful Moms And Dad: Low Warmth, Low Control.
The uncaring parenting style, likewise described as uninvolved parenting, is characterized by reduced levels of both warmth and control. Unmindful moms and dads are commonly disengaged and unresponsive to their children's requirements. They might offer basic necessities however are emotionally far-off and uninvolved in their youngsters's lives. This parenting design can stem from different factors, including adult stress and anxiety, mental health concerns, or a absence of understanding of youngster development.
Youngsters increased by uncaring parents usually experience one of the most adverse outcomes. They might deal with social and psychological development, have reduced self-confidence, show inadequate academic performance, and go to a greater danger Children for behavior issues and substance abuse. The absence of parental involvement and assistance can cause sensations of desertion and instability, dramatically impacting their total well-being.
Beyond the 4 Styles: Subtleties and Influencing Elements.
It is essential to acknowledge that these 4 parenting styles stand for wide categories, and real-life parenting is usually extra nuanced and vibrant. Moms and dads might exhibit various designs in different circumstances or with different kids. Furthermore, social backgrounds, socioeconomic aspects, and specific child characters can affect the efficiency and appropriateness of certain parenting techniques.
As an example, social standards in some societies might highlight stricter discipline and obedience, while others prioritize autonomy and self-expression. Likewise, a child with a challenging character might need a various parenting strategy than a youngster who is naturally a lot more relaxed.
The Importance of Responsiveness and Uniformity.
Despite the certain design, two crucial elements constantly become essential for favorable youngster growth: responsiveness and uniformity. Receptive parents are in harmony with their youngsters's demands and react in a delicate and appropriate way. This fosters a secure accessory and helps kids really feel understood and valued. Regular parenting, on the other hand, involves establishing clear assumptions and implementing them naturally. This supplies children with a sense of security and helps them discover borders and self-regulation.
